Daily Coronavirus Cases In Alabama Triple Since Reopening Surpass 1 000 New Infections In A Day For The First Time

The state’s latest daily case count was 1,014, the Alabama Department of Public Health reported Sunday, with over 1,000 new infections seen in 24 hours for the first time since the outbreak began. Sunday’s daily case count is nearly triple the figure reported on May 12, a day after the state began reopening some venues, with around 300 new cases reported that day. It is also more than doubled the figure recorded on May 23, a day after the state’s amended “Safe at Home” order expired, with 447 new infections reported that day, according to data compiled by Johns Hopkins University....

Cryptocurrency Is A Ponzi Scheme. It S Time To Regulate It Opinion

Many Americans have lost their shirts. So why isn’t crypto regulated like other financial assets? First, some history. Eighty nine years ago, the Banking Act of 1933, also known as the Glass-Steagall Act, was signed into law by Franklin D. Roosevelt. It separated commercial banking from investment banking—Main Street from Wall Street—to protect people who entrusted their savings to commercial banks from having their money gambled away. Glass-Steagall’s larger purpose was to put an end to the giant Ponzi scheme that had overtaken the American economy in the 1920s and led to the Great Crash of 1929....
